Lighting and Atmosphere
Lighting and atmosphere are crucial in establishing a game’s mood. He must carefully consider the placement and intensity of light sources. This choice can dramatically affect player immersion. For example, soft lighting can create a serene environment, while harsh lighting may induce tension. Additionally, dynamic lighting can enhance realism and responsiveness. This technique keeps players engaged. Furthermore, shadows play a significant role in depth perception. They can guide player attention effectively. A well-executed lighting design enriches the overall experience. Isn’t that essential for captivating players?

Optimization Techniques
Optimization techniques are essential for enhancing performance in 3D design. He must focus on reducing polygon counts without sacrificing quality. This approach can significantly improve rendering speeds. Additionally, texture compression is vital for efficient memory usage. Smaller textures can lead to faster load times. Furthermore, implementing level of detail (LOD) techniques can optimize rendering based on distance. This method conserves resources while maintaining visual fidelity. Regular profiling helps identify bottlenecks in performance. Addressing these issues can enhance user experience. Isn’t that crucial for player satisfaction?
